IV, Charles Dunsmore Fox, was born on January 12, 1953 in Roanoke, Virginia, United States. Son of Charles Dunsmore III and Preston (Wescoat) F.
AB, Princeton University, 1975; Master of Arts, Yale University, 1977; Juris Doctor, University of Virginia, 1980.
Associate Schiff, Hardin & Waite, Chicago, 1980-1986, partner, 1987—2005, McGuire Woods LLP, Charlottesville, Virginia, since 2005. Partner chairman Economics of Practice of Trusts and Estates Magazine, Atlanta, 1995-1998. Adjunct professor Northwestern University School Law, 1998-2005.
University Virginia Law School, since 2005. Elected member Estate Planning Hall of Fame, 2008.
Active University Virginia Law School Foundation, Charlottesville, 1992-1995, vice-chair national appeals, 1997-1998, chair national appeals, 1998-2000. Trustee Virginia Law School Foundation, since 1998, LaGrange Memorial Foundation, 1994-1996, Episcopal High School, Alexandria, Virginia, 1995-2001, chair capital campaign, 1998-2001. General counsel Community Memorial Foundation, LaGrange, Illinois, since 1995.
Co-chair planned giving task force Episcopal Diocese of Chicago, 2001-2005. Board directors St. Annes-Belfield Foundation, 2005-2008, Arc of Piedmont, 2005-2010, Camp Holiday Trails, since 2008. Fellow American College Trust and Estate Counsel (co-chair legal education committee 2002-2005, assistant editor journal 2004-2005, editor 2005-2006, regent since 2006, chair editorial board 2008-2010, chair communications committee since 2010), Duke University Estate Planning Council (chair).
Member American Bar Association, Princeton University Planned Giving Advisory Council.
Married Elizabeth McCabe, December 16, 1989. Children: Charles Dunsmore V, Edward Lee McCabe.
